#273d74 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#273d74 is composed of 15.3% red, 23.9%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 47.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 222.9 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 30.4%. #273d74 color hex could be obtained by blending #4e7ae8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#273d74

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04070d is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#273d74

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4c50 is the less saturated color, while #032e98 is the most saturated one.
